The Fulfillment organization provides seamless support to customers, both internal and external, modernizing how to receive, track, and deliver parts. Fulfillment manages products from on dock through last stage kitting to point of use. Areas of responsibility include but not limited to: hazmat and consumables, standards, small and bulk parts, tooling, expedite, and material integration center support. Position Responsibilities:
- Applies Industrial Engineering and/or lean concepts, techniques, analysis and decision tools to promote and implement changes in manufacturing, engineering and service operations.
- Develops models, data bases and/or spreadsheets to analyze data and provides summary analysis and metrics for consultation to customers (e.g., management, departments, suppliers).
- Assists in the identification and implementation of process improvements by analyzing current processes and utilizing established improvement methodologies to maximize the efficiency of equipment and personnel and to support company improvement initiatives.
- Analyzes and designs value stream, including capability, capacity (e.g., make/buy, supplier selection, risk analysis, supplier performance), throughput, work flow and logistics (e.g., critical path, lead-time, transportation, factory layout).
- Supports efforts to develop, implement, maintain and monitor status of shop operating plans to maximize the efficiency of equipment and personnel in order to meet schedule commitments.
- Gathers and analyzes shop performance metrics in order to support a recommended plan of action.
